Tiny Tactile Pushbutton Switch From knitter-switch Features Horizontal Stem

Knitter-switch announced a very small, tactile, pushbutton switch that now completes its popular TS/TSS 4500 series. Unlike other models in the 4500 series, the TS 4533 – RA pushbutton switch has a horizontal stem making it ideal for a variety of applications that demand a very small and very robust momentary action pushbutton.

With a total height off the board of just 5.2mm, the through-hole mounting knitter-switch TS 4533-RA switch features a choice of operating actuation forces of 100, 160 or 260gf and an operating lifetime of 50,000 cycles.

Featuring a hard polyamide stem, the TS 4533-RA tactile pushbutton switch is particularly suitable as a reset switch to be operated by a pen, screwdriver or probe.

Typical applications for the knitter-switch TS 4533-RA reset switch include satellite navigation systems, PDAs, communications equipment such as modems and routers, entertainment and games consoles, television set-top boxes, medical products, home appliances and industrial control and instrumentation equipment.
